<small>The aim of the study was to investigate whether normal aging leads to blood cells being produced from fewer cell clones. This was examined by comparing which X chromosome the cells were using between different age groups and between neutrophils and T cells.</small>
|
||||
|
||||
<small>In other words, they studied human hematopoiesis acros s age by analyzing purified blood cell lineages from the subjects.</small>

## Study
|
||||
- 197 hematologically normal females
|
||||
- 23 newborn - taken during delivery
|
||||
- 94 young adult - age: 17-50 median 30
|
||||
- 80 eldery - age: 75-96 median 81
|
||||
- purified neutrofils
|
||||
- purified T-cells
|
||||
----
|
||||
### Methods
|
||||
1. <small>Peripheral blood samples were collected</small>
|
||||
2. <small>Neutrophils and T cells were isolated using cell separation techniques _(centrifugation followed by lineage-specific purification)_</small>
|
||||
3. <small>X-chromosome inactivation was analyzed using the HUMARA PCR assay _(PCR-based measurement of which X chromosome is active)_</small>
|
||||
4. <small>T cells were analyzed by PCR to check for clonal expansion _(T-cell receptor γ gene rearrangement analysis)_</small >
